Home
last modified time | relevance | path

Searched refs:insertDecl (Results 1 – 6 of 6) sorted by relevance

/llvm-project/clang-tools-extra/clangd/unittests/
H A DInsertionPointTests.cpp75 auto Edit = insertDecl("foo;", NS, {Anchor{StartsWith("a"), Anchor::Below}}); in TEST()
80 Edit = insertDecl("x;", NS, {Anchor{StartsWith("no_match"), Anchor::Below}}); in TEST()
128 auto Edit = insertDecl("x", C, {}, AS_public); in TEST()
133 Edit = insertDecl("x", C, {}, AS_private); in TEST()
138 Edit = insertDecl("x", C, {}, AS_protected); in TEST()
157 ASSERT_THAT_EXPECTED(insertDecl("x", S, {}, AS_public), in TEST()
159 ASSERT_THAT_EXPECTED(insertDecl("x", S, {}, AS_private), in TEST()
165 ASSERT_THAT_EXPECTED(insertDecl("x", T, {}, AS_public), in TEST()
167 ASSERT_THAT_EXPECTED(insertDecl("x", T, {}, AS_private), in TEST()
173 ASSERT_THAT_EXPECTED(insertDecl("x", U, {}, AS_public), in TEST()
[all …]
/llvm-project/clang-tools-extra/clangd/refactor/
H A DInsertionPoint.h39 llvm::Expected<tooling::Replacement> insertDecl(llvm::StringRef Code,
50 llvm::Expected<tooling::Replacement> insertDecl(llvm::StringRef Code,
H A DInsertionPoint.cpp113 insertDecl(llvm::StringRef Code, const DeclContext &DC, in insertDecl() function
136 llvm::Expected<tooling::Replacement> insertDecl(llvm::StringRef Code, in insertDecl() function
/llvm-project/clang-tools-extra/clangd/refactor/tweaks/
H A DObjCMemberwiseInitializer.cpp284 insertDecl(initializerForParams(Params, /*GenerateImpl=*/false), in apply()
297 auto ImplReplacement = insertDecl( in apply()
H A DSpecialMembers.cpp135 auto Edit = insertDecl(Code, *Class, std::move(Anchors), AS_public); in apply()
H A DMemberwiseConstructor.cpp114 auto Edit = insertDecl(Code, *Class, std::move(Anchors), AS_public); in apply()